Citizenship by naturalization By way of the process of naturalization one who is not a citizen of the United States may become one. The steps of the naturalization procedure are: (1) file an application. (2) take an examination (3) file a legal petition for naturalization (4) appear at a court hearing and finally (5) take an oath of allegiance. It is of course necessary to meet certain requirements before one can become a citizen. The applicant must be a legal adult (otherwise they gain citizenship when their parents do), and have entered the country in a legal manner. They also must have been a resident of the U.S. for at least five successive years before beginning the application process. Besides that, the aspirant to citizenship must fully realize the English language (be able to read, write, and speak in English) and show proficient knowledge of American history and government. The correct answer is they had little opportunity to receive a formal education.
Indentured servants were individuals who were hired to work on a farm or plantation for 4-7 years. In return, this person would have their trip to American paid for and the opportunity to own a small amount of land after their service was completed. Slaves, on the other hand, were bought and sold like property.
Both indentured servants and slaves reported to their masters and spent almost all of their days on the farm/plantation. With this in mind, neither group of people had time for a formal education. Along with this, many states made it illegal to educate slaves. Educating the lower class could open their eyes to the corrupt system they were a part of.

Citizens participate in democratic governments by voting, running for public office and forming or joining political parties. This is a general statement and does not cover all aspects of participation avenues for citizens.
An ordered government is one with orderly regulations between all parts of government and state. A limited government is one that has regulations placed on it for what it can and can not do, such as, and generally including, ensuring the rights of it's citizens. A representative government is one in which officials are elected by the general populace to create public policies.
